The progress in US-Russia relations would benefit both countries, US State Secretary John Kerry said.

MOSCOW (Sputnik) — The progress in US-Russia relations is in the interests of both countries as well as history and the future, US State Secretary John Kerry said.

"Sergey Lavrov and I talk almost every week, regularly, and we are working effectively even with differences to try to find a path forward," Kerry said in an interview with Rossiya 24 television during his visit to Moscow.

"I think that’s in the interests of the American people and the Russian people. It’s in the interests of history and the future," Kerry stressed.
